A. CSS编码练习时,设置了层和图片的宽与高,但是显示时高度被自动压缩了一半,是怎么回事呢
你css代码贴的不详细,有时候你看着不对的地方不一定是它自己有问题,很可能是它旁边的元素造成的,我目测你的图片,很有可能是因为你上面的导航没有清除浮动或者绝对定位了,以至于下面的图片跑上去压在了导航下面。
B. JS/CSS 压缩有什么好处
JS和CSS经过压缩之后体积变小,也就是文件占用内存会变小
在访问网站的时候要加载JS和CSS,体积越小,加载越快。
网站打开的速度也就越快,有利于用户体验。
C. CSS文件的压缩和格式化有什么区别,格式化是什么意思
格式化就是以一种可读性较高的方式呈现(排列)CSS中的样式。
普通的压缩就是减去空格和换行,还有些数据量比较大的CSS文件,则还会将每条规则的id或class的名称用简短的字符代替,实现更细致的压缩。
D. web中对JS和CSS的源代码进行压缩,是什么意思
压缩是去掉多余的空格和注释,同时将变量名改为少量字符组成的名字减小js文件体积,加快下载
E. 手动压缩js,css文件和gzip压缩的区别
所谓的手动/自动压缩js、css一般是将js的变量名变短,js和css的无关空格删除等
gzip压缩是将文件通过压缩算法进行的一种无损压缩
举个简单的例子:
手动压缩相当于把代码用最精简的方式写出来(变量都用一个字母,去掉空格换行,一些写法换成更短的等价写法)
而gzip是相当于把文件打包成压缩文件
F. 为什么css没有压缩成功
试试把webpack的devtool设置为false
修改你的less配置
{ test: /\.less$/,
use: ExtractTextPlugin.extract({
fallback: 'style-loader',
use: ['css-loader', 'less-loader']
})
},
new ExtractTextPlugin({
//生成css文件名 filename: 'static/css/[name].css', disable: false, allChunks: true
}),
G. 如何知道css代码是否压缩优化
您好,CSS压缩优化是在保持原有功能的情况下减少CSS的体积,以达到更好的访问速度。
从书写格式上可以轻易分辨:
例原版CSS代码为:
blockquote:before,blockquote:after,
q:before,q:after{
content:'';
content:none;
}
压缩后代码为:
blockquote:before,q:after,q:before{content:'';content:none}
网络中有许多在线美化和压缩的工具网页链接
H. css代码为什么要压缩、精简
need for speed
在线压的没你手动的好 好好研究吧.
I. CSS的CSS压缩方法
理想的情况是只拥有一个CSS文件(如果你使用RWD以支持IE的老版本,那就需要两个CSS文件。)构建并维护几个单独的CSS文件也算合理,但在部署到产品服务器之前,你应该将它们集合在一起,并删掉那些不必要的空白区域。
Saas、LESS和Stylus等预处理器可帮你完成这些痛苦的工作。 Grunt.js、 Gulp等工具可自动化你的工作流。如果你更喜欢GUI,可借助Koala提供的免费跨平台应用。
如果你觉得这些比较麻烦,也可手动通过命令行工具将CSS文件集中在一起,如在Windows中,可使用如下代码:
在Mac/Linux中,可使用如下代码:
最终文件经过在线CSS压缩工具(如 cssminifier.com、 CSS Compressor & Minifieror等)压缩后即可运行。
最后,请记住在头部(Head)加载所有CSS,以便浏览器展示接下来的HTML元素,同时也可避免浏览器下次再重绘页面元素。
J. css div 尺寸怎么被压缩了,哪里错了
把两个font=size改为font-size